This course teaches you how to build your own QuickBooks clone without touching a single line of code.

It covers the step-by-step process of creating an invoice and expense-tracking app that’s ready to launch.

Utilizing Bubble’s no-code platform, you’ll learn the exact design, database, and workflows to replicate the QuickBooks product.

By the end of this course, you’ll have a working product that can be used to build your own startup, knowledge on how to build a Quickbooks clone for freelance clients, and new skills to expand your Bubble experience. Here's the full list of modules of this course:

1. Getting started with Bubble

2. Configuring your database

3. Designing the marketing page

4. Registering user accounts

5. Building a login page

6. Creating a user settings page

7. Inviting team members to a shared workspace

8. Designing the main dashboard page of QuickBooks

9. Making the app fully-responsive across mobile & desktop

10. Building a CRM to create & store customer details
